When was Pamunkey Indian Tribe Museum created?

Pamunkey Indian Tribe Museum was created in 1979.

Who owns pamunkey regional jail?

The Pamunkey Regional Jail is owned and operated by a regional jail authority comprised of several localities in Virginia, specifically King William, King and Queen, and New Kent counties. This collaborative approach allows these jurisdictions to share resources and manage the facility collectively, addressing the needs of their communities regarding incarceration and rehabilitation.
